arxanas / scm-recordLinks
`scm-record` is a UI component to interactively select changes to include in a commit. It's meant to be embedded in source control tooling.
☆78Updated last month
Alternatives and similar repositories for scm-record
Users that are interested in scm-record are comparing it to the libraries listed below
Sorting:
- Edit diffs in a 3-pane view☆76Updated last week
- A modal interface for Jujutsu☆66Updated 2 weeks ago
- Cozy Rust bindings to the tree-sitter C library and a robust highlighter☆94Updated last week
- Generate bookmark names from commit messages, to push as branches, with Jujutsu VCS☆32Updated 7 months ago
- job control from anywhere!☆64Updated 3 months ago
- CLI tool to conditionally execute commands only when files in a dependency list have been updated. Like `make`, but standalone.☆135Updated 2 years ago
- Text UI for Jujutsu based on fzf, centering around the jj log with key bindings for common operations☆196Updated this week
- A Rust library for building modal editing applications☆75Updated 2 months ago
- A language server for just☆128Updated 2 weeks ago
- Dive into a file's history to find root cause☆66Updated 3 weeks ago
- A command line tool for datetime arithmetic, parsing, formatting and more.☆270Updated last week
- A library for answering the question «Is this terminal dark or light?» 🦕☆65Updated last week
- Brewfile is better than configuration.nix☆116Updated 3 weeks ago
- Finally, a shell for all seasons!☆122Updated 9 months ago
- ☆44Updated last month
- A cross-platform VT manipulation library☆41Updated last month
- Strongly typed YAML library for Rust☆38Updated 2 months ago
- Nitpicking commit history since beabf39☆134Updated 3 weeks ago
- codesort sorts code☆98Updated 8 months ago
- A Djot parser library☆191Updated 2 weeks ago
- A little tool so I don't forget to commit and push or pull changes when switching computers.☆66Updated 7 months ago
- A conflict resolution merge tool for Jujutsu VCS that runs in Neovim☆53Updated this week
- Fork of spacedentist/spr with support for Jujutsu (jj) and commit signing☆56Updated 2 weeks ago
- Rewriting Shellcheck in Rust☆71Updated 2 years ago
- Declarative bash/fish/zsh completions without writing shell scripts☆280Updated last week
- prompt library for rust☆157Updated this week
- An unopinionated Rust library for locating configuration, data and cache directories across platforms☆117Updated last month
- Rust KDL parser and derive implementation☆34Updated 3 months ago
- ☆43Updated last month
- ☆134Updated 4 months ago